第四章单元测试
修改SC表中的约束C3使得大学生的年龄在18到40之间的约束为:
ALTER TABLE Student ADD CONSTRAINT C3 CHECK(Sage <30 and Sage >15);下列关于数据完整性的说法正确的是( )
要求表中的列在组成主键的属性上不能为空值,这是( )
要在SQL Server中创建一个员工信息表,其中员工的薪水、医疗保险和养老保险分别采用三个字段来存储,但是该公司规定:任何一个员工,医疗保险和养老保险两项之和不能大于薪水的1/3,这一项规则可以采用( )来实现。
语句insert into Student values(('201215121','司马光','男','400','CS'), ('201215121','欧阳修','男','400','CS'))可以正确执行。
A:错 B:对
答案:错
A:利用主键约束的列不能有重复的值,但允许NULL值 B:记录中某个字段值为NULL,表示该列上没有值 C: 实体完整性要求每个实体都必须有一个主键或其他的唯一标识列 D:外键是用来维护两个表之间的级联关系
A:用户定义完整性规则 B: 参照完整性规则 C:实体完整性规则 D:域完整性规则
A: 主键约束 B:外键约束 C:默认约束 D:检查约束
A:对 B:错
温馨提示支付 ¥3.00 元后可查看付费内容,请先翻页预览!